ESDS Software Solutions Debuts On NSE With 76% Premium Over IPO Price

NDTV Profit 1 hr ago·4 Sept 2026, 4:47 am

ESDS Software Solutions made its stock market debut on the NSE with a strong opening, trading significantly above its issue price. The company’s shares saw a premium of 76%, reflecting high demand from investors during its initial public offering.

This strong market reception indicates that investors are optimistic about the company’s growth prospects and its position in the IT and software services sector. The oversubscription of the IPO, which was subscribed over 135 times, further underscores the confidence among retail and institutional investors.
